Real Madrid will take on Club Brugge on Wednesday in 2019/20 UEFA Champions League as the tournament moves ahead. Los Blancos go into this game as the favourites.

Kick-off : 9:00 PM (Local)

Venue : Jan Breydel Stadium, Bruges

Real Madrid have not played the football they are known for in the group stages overall and that can be seen by their position in the group.

Los Blancos are currently second in their group after five matches with just 8 points. The goal difference is +4.

Though qualification to the last 16 is secured but they are not going to win the group. PSG have already won the group. Club Brugge should be tricky opponents.

With nothing to loose Club Brugge will definitely come all guns blazing. So Zinedine Zidane’s men will have to go carefully about their business in Belgium.

A tight defence will go a long way. A winning habit is what they should look for. Try and score as many as you can to get the match practice for some tougher games to come in the knockout phase.

On the other hand, Club Brugge have had a disappointing campaign as they find themselves out of contention for a place in the last 16. They play for pride in their last game of 2019/20 UEFA Champions League.

Club Brugge are third in the group after five matches with just 3 points in their kitty. The goal difference is -6.

Team news and possible line-ups

Krepin Diatta and Clinton Mata will both be unavailable for the Real Madrid game as due to suspension.

As for Los Blancos, Eden Hazard is injured and hence will be unavailable.

Club Brugge XI : Mignolet, Kossounou, Mechele, Deli, Ricca, Alvarez, Rits, Vanaken, Schrijvers, Bonaventure, Okereke.

Real Madrid XI : Courtois, Militao, Varane, Ramos, Mendy, Casemiro, Valverde, Modric, Rodrygo, Benzema, Vinicius.
